Dozens of service stations across Australia have run out of petrol as distributors struggle to keep up with customers panic-buying as the conflict in the Middle East continues to disrupt prices.
The NRMA has warned regulators missed" the chance to stop price hikes, as booming wholesale demand pushes fuel prices to a permanent high" on the east coast.
